{{{ $ cabal get cryptohash-sha256-0.11.101.0 $ cd cryptohash-sha256-0.11.101.0 $ cabal new-run -w ghc-8.6.1 --enable-test --allow- newer=*:base,*:stm,*:tasty test:test-sha256 -- -j 8 --quickcheck-tests 9999 }}}
Eventually the program will start spamming stderr with `test-sha256: lost signal due to full pipe: 11` repeatedly. This apparently only started with 8.6.1.
